Abstract

This invention provides isolated thermostable peptides and their uses in cell biology research, regenerative medicine and related medical applications or cosmetics, wherein the thermostable peptides have FGF2 activity and at least 85% sequence identity with SEQ ID NO:2 (FGF2wt) or its functional fragment and contain at least one amino acid substituted for R31L. In addition, a culture medium containing the aforementioned FGF2 is disclosed, which is suitable for culturing human pluripotent stem cells involving both human embryonic stem cells and induced pluripotent stem cells.
